Description
Major-General Merton Beckwith-Smith DSO, MC, a distinguished but previously overlooked hero of the British army, is the subject of this compelling new biography. Eighty years after his death in a Japanese prison camp, his remarkable story is finally being told.
Beckwith-Smith commanded the British 18th Division during the catastrophic Fall of Singapore in February 1942, and his leadership played a significant role in the events that followed. Despite being captured along with tens of thousands of other soldiers, he rallied the spirits of his men, created a makeshift university and theatre, and helped to inspire a remarkable renewal of collective church life.
This biography, based on exclusive access to family archives and drawing on an array of other eyewitness accounts, brings to an end the neglect surrounding Beckwith-Smith's life and legacy. It offers vivid insights into one man's experience of two world wars, and reveals why he was so admired by his fellow officers and the ordinary soldiers who served under him.
